The contract entails the supply and delivery of 1,000 quarts of Toluene identified by NSN 6810005798431 to Sioux City, Iowa, under a subcontract issued by the Defense Logistics Agency on behalf of the Department of Defense. All materials must comply with federal procurement standards including DFARS, DPAS, and MIL-STD packaging specifications to ensure proper handling, transportation, and regulatory compliance. The North American Industry Classification System code 325110 indicates the work falls under the chemical manufacturing sector, aligning with the specialized nature of the chemical supply. Performance is mandated at the specified delivery location with no set-aside classifications applied, and the contract was posted on July 16, 2026, with the award linked through the DIBBS system under contract number SPE4AX16D9008 and delivery identifier SPE4A626FCSSQ.
